Cosmetic Procedures Offered
Blepharoplasty (Eyelid Surgery)
Blepharoplasty is a surgical procedure to remove excess skin, fat, or muscle from the upper and/or lower eyelids. It addresses drooping upper eyelids that may impair vision and reduces puffiness or bags under the eyes, resulting in a more youthful and alert appearance.
Lower blepharoplasty — reduces under-eye bags and puffiness
Ptosis Correction
Ptosis is the drooping of the upper eyelid due to weakness of the levator muscle. This condition can obstruct vision and affect appearance. Surgical correction restores normal eyelid position and improves both function and aesthetics.
Epicanthoplasty
A procedure to modify the inner corner fold of the eye (epicanthal fold) to create a more open and defined eye appearance.
Chalazion Removal
Surgical removal of persistent eyelid cysts (chalazia) that do not respond to conservative treatment.
Entropion and Ectropion Correction
Surgical correction of inward-turning (entropion) or outward-turning (ectropion) eyelids that can cause irritation, tearing, and vision problems.
Lacrimal (Tear Duct) Surgery
Procedures to treat blocked or abnormal tear ducts causing excessive tearing or recurring infections.

Recovery and Aftercare
Mild swelling and bruising are normal and resolve within 1–2 weeks
Cold compresses help reduce swelling in the early days
Prescribed eye drops and medications should be used as directed
Avoid strenuous activity and rubbing the eyes during recovery
Follow-up visits are essential for monitoring healing
